Lord Falacer of Big-Antium receives his guests with grace. Unfortunately neither he, nor his wife have seen their son since he fled from Antwarp. Nevertheless they have a story to tell.
"He was always a bit difficult, ever since he was a larva," Lord Falacar explains, "He resented that we were not Kings of Antium as our ancestors had been. At first he would say Antium should be ours. As he grew older, he said that we should be the true heirs to the throne, since the Queen was only a female. He felt that only males should rule. We tried to explain to him that ruling required actual skills and that the queen was our sovereign. But he would not listen. As a young ant freshly hatched from his pupa, he decided to leave Antonesia. He told us he was looking for a more sane kingdom. He was gone for many years. When he returned, he had changed. We thought, when he entered the Queen's service that he had matured, we rejoiced in his sucess. We were blind to his faults. We should have seen the storm coming, we should have warned her Majesty. But, he is our son, no matter what, we still love him."
"Do you have any idea where he could be?" Agatha Misty askes.
"Alas no, we fear he may have fled the country." Lord Falacar answers.
"Do you know where he might have learned some magic?" Lord Dogula wants to know.
"We did not even know he could do magic until he revealed that himself." Lord Falacar sais. "He must have learned it during his travels."
"There are only a few schools of magic he could have gone to," Lord Dogula sais. "I suggest we split up again. Miss Misty and I will travel to these schools of magic, while you, my dear Wiskerteers, should track down that smith who vanished when Lord Laverno did."
They all agree to this plan, knowing full well that the task ahead of them will be monumental.
